Solution-Focused Brief Therapy is a short-term, goals focused, evidence-based approach…which helps clients change by constructing solutions rather than focusing on problems. (https://solutionfocused.net/what-is-solution-focused-therapy/ 2022)
Social Workers seek to empower the people they work with and liberate them from social injustice. While Solution-Focused techniques may be most useful in working at a micro level, the principles align with the belief that individuals are the experts in their lives and have the strength and knowledge to build creative solutions towards change. In promoting this belief, we, as Social Workers, promote the values we hold of respect for persons, social justice, and professional integrity.
Incorporating these techniques into practice demonstrates the power of Social Work as a profession and provides a solid framework for Social Work practice in the challenging field of crisis and short intervention work.
When a person accesses a crisis service or a service offering short intervention they are often distressed, have many issues converging, or find it difficult to choose what they wish to work on. Understanding how to support an individual to make the best use of their, and your, expertise is challenging.
This webinar recording draws on Solution-Focused Brief Therapy, Client Directed-Outcome Informed Therapy, and the Neurosequential Model of Therapeutics. The techniques from these models will allow practitioners to maintain clarity in another’s crisis, modify their and their client’s expectations of what can be done, and help their clients to achieve small, but important goals to set the foundations for ongoing recovery and/or thriving in the face of adversity.
